WebSep 8, 2024 · The second chamber of the Wallace Monument, Hall of Heroes, contains the busts of 16 notable Scots, including Robbie Burns, Robert the Bruce, David Livingstone, Walter Scott, James Watt, John Knox … WebThe statue of Wallace on the exterior was erected in 1887 and was by David W Stevenson. In 1912 a monument was erected at the supposed site of his birth at Elderslie, near Paisley. In 1955 a plaque was placed at St Bartholomew's Hospital, London, marking the spot where he had been put to death on 23 August 1305.

WebThe Wallace Monument stands on Abbey Craig, near Stirling. On September 11, 1297 atop the heights of the rocky promontory, the Scots army stood poised. William Wallace and Andrew de Moray’s troops watched the farcical crossing of the English host over Stirling Bridge. They knew the time was ripe for a strike. They stormed down the Craig ... WebThe Wallace Monument is a national landmark dedicated to Scotland’s national hero, William Wallace (1270-1305). What is inside the Wallace Monument? The Wallace Monument is home to displays and exhibitions that depict the life of William Wallace and Scotland during the time he was alive.
